Indoles with carbocyclic halogen or triflate substituents are potential starting materials for vinylation, arylation and acylation via palladium-catalysed pro-cesses[l]. Indolylstannanes. indolylzinc halides and indolylboronic acids are also potential reactants. The principal type of substitution which is excluded from such coupling reactions is alkylation, since saturated alkyl groups tend to give elimination products in Pd-catalysed processes. [Pg.141]

These workers have developed another new type of chiral S/N ligands, namely aziridine sulfides, which were easily synthesised in a straightforward synthetic route from inexpensive and readily available (i )-cysteine. The efficiency of this sterically and electronically varied set of ligands was then examined as chiral catalysts in the palladium-catalysed test reaction. The alkylated product was obtained in excellent yields and stereoselectivities of up to 99% ee, as shown in Scheme 1.44. [Pg.38]

The palladium catalysed sequential alkylation-alkenylation of 5-iodoquinoline leads to the formation of the quinolooxepin ring system (5.20.), The process, closely related to the Catellani reaction,19 runs through an ort/zo-alkylation - Heck reaction sequence. The preparation of a series of benzoxepines has also been achieved in this manner, starting from such iodobenzene derivatives, where one of the or/7 o-positions was blocked by substitution.20... [Pg.94]

Thus the alkyl ester end groups of convergently grown poly(benzyl ether) dendrimers can be subjected to post-synthetic modification by hydrolysis [28], reduction [29], transesterification/amidation [28] in a variety of ways. Subsequent modification of poly(benzyl ether) dendrons bearing p-bromobenzyl end groups by palladium-catalysed coupling reactions permitted preparation of dendrons with phenyl, pyridinyl, or thiophenyl end groups [30]. [Pg.54]

The Suzuki Coupling, which is the palladium-catalysed cross coupling between organoboronic acid and halides. Recent catalyst and methods developments have broadened the possible applications enormously, so that the scope of the reaction partners is not restricted to aryls, but includes alkyls, alkenyls and alkynyls. Potassium trifluoroborates and organoboranes or boronate esters may be used in place of boronic acids. Some pseudohalides (for example triflates) may also be used as coupling partners. [Pg.226]
